There was a clash of titans last night at Liberty High School. As the Jays hammered Park Hill.

Now you have to understand a dual doesn’t have implications on the team race at the state tournament.

Park Hill is going to bank on their 7 medalists at the state tournament. Liberty can’t falter at the state tournament like they did last year.

Lenger and Rathjen are key in their team race and if they can actually get some production out of their big guys no one will catch them.
